Dll File Interpretation. by OmniPotens(m): 8:38pm On Oct 07, 2011
I want to read up the contents of some .dll files from a software. How do I go about doing this? Any leads on may be a software or procedures I can use to do this?

Re: Dll File Interpretation. by whoelse(m): 6:30am On Oct 08, 2011
@OminPotens,
Yea, you can reverse engineer them. If its a .NET dll, then you can check up Reflector [/b]by [b]RedGate. It doen't work perfectly though, you may just need to re-write code here and there but its accuracy is about 90%. (Unobfuscated code only grin).
